Photo Flash: In Rehearsal With AIDA At Axelrod Performing Arts Center
by A.A. Cristi - May 23, 2019


The Axelrod Performing Arts Center reunites with Luis Salgado and the team from Salgado Productions for their third collaboration, "Elton John and Tim Rice's AIDA," opening May 31, 2019. Previously for the theater, Salgado directed and choreographed "In the Heights" in 2017 and "Ragtime The Musical"  in 2018, both of which received nominations for best regional production of a musical.

Sundance Institute Presents: The Farewell LA Premiere Hosted by Acura
by Tori Hartshorn - May 21, 2019


Sundance Institute, in collaboration with A24, invites fans and supporters of independent cinema to celebrate writer/director Lulu Wang with a special premiere screening of her film The Farewell and afterparty at The Theatre at Ace Hotel DTLA on Wednesday, June 26, 2019. Wang, an alumna of Sundance Institute's 2017 FilmTwo Initiative, will be honored with the Institute's annual Vanguard Award presented by Acura at the summer benefit. Proceeds from the evening will advance Sundance Institute's mission and programs that discover, support and amplify risk-taking and exciting independent artists across film, theatre and media. 

Compagnia De' Colombari Presents MORE OR LESS I AM At Fort Greene Park
by Julie Musbach - May 20, 2019


Compagnia de' Colombari, an international collective of performing artists founded and directed by Karin Coonrod, presents More Or Less I Am: a music-theater piece drawn entirely from Walt Whitman's revolutionary free verse long poem, 'Song of Myself,'one of the original twelve pieces that comprise his 1855 collection Leaves of Grass. The next performance in this series, spanning multiple venues throughout the five boroughs, will take place on Sunday, May 26, 2019, 7:30 pm at Fort Greene Park, Brooklyn.

Josh Ritter's FEVER BREAKS Debuts Top Five On Billboard's Americana/Folk Albums Chart
by Tori Hartshorn - May 7, 2019


Acclaimed singer and songwriter Josh Ritter's new album, Fever Breaks, debuts at #4 on Billboard's Americana/Folk Albums Chart, #5 on Independent Albums Chart, #14 on Top Current Albums Chart and appears on the Billboard 200. Produced by Grammy Award-winning musician Jason Isbell, the 10-track album was recorded at Nashville's historic RCA Studio A and features Isbell's band, the 400 Unit.

SHAME OF THRONES: The Musical Back From Off-Broadway Updated & Unrated!
by A.A. Cristi - May 1, 2019


The Whitefire Theatre Musical Mondays is proud to present SHAME OF THRONES: The Musical, directed by Rachel Stein, produced by Steven Christopher Parker, Steven Brandon, Erin Stegeman, and Ace Marrero. Just in time for Game of Thrones' final season, the musical spoof SHAME OF THRONES: The Musical returns to L.A. for more hilarious re-imagining of the show's backstabbing siblings, clever imps and dragon mamas, all set to an addictive rock score that'll stick in your head (unless the king orders it off, natch). The musical parody will run May 13 - July 8, Monday evenings at 8 pm, at the Whitefire Theatre in Sherman Oaks, California.

The TSO Announces May Lineup
by Stephi Wild - Apr 11, 2019


The month of May at the Toronto Symphony Orchestra (TSO) is an ode to the genius of some of the greatest composers of all time, and some of today's most brilliant pianists. An all-Mozart program features revered American pianist Jeremy Denk, and celebrated Canadian piano virtuoso Louis Lortie joins the TSO for two different programs. Not-to-be-missed concerts include Beethoven Symphony 5, Mahler Symphony 7, and Pines of Rome.
